edit Makefile to build for linux amd64 and arm 5
This commit is contained in:
parent
0eb6c10550
commit
4d33b68660
1
.gitignore
vendored
1
.gitignore
vendored
@ -21,4 +21,5 @@ go.work
|
|||||||
/.vscode
|
/.vscode
|
||||||
|
|
||||||
/cmd/git_version.go
|
/cmd/git_version.go
|
||||||
|
/dist
|
||||||
.env
|
.env
|
||||||
|
|||||||
7
Makefile
7
Makefile
@ -1,4 +1,6 @@
|
|||||||
BIN_NAME=hasshelper
|
BIN_NAME=hasshelper
|
||||||
|
OSLIST=linux
|
||||||
|
ARCHLIST=arm64 amd64
|
||||||
|
|
||||||
default: all
|
default: all
|
||||||
|
|
||||||
@ -12,7 +14,8 @@ generate: init
|
|||||||
go generate
|
go generate
|
||||||
|
|
||||||
build: generate
|
build: generate
|
||||||
go build -o ${BIN_NAME}
|
env GOARCH=arm GOARM=5 GOOS=linux go build -o dist/${BIN_NAME}_linux_arm_5
|
||||||
|
env GOARCH=amd64 GOOS=linux go build -o dist/${BIN_NAME}_linux_amd64
|
||||||
|
|
||||||
test: generate
|
test: generate
|
||||||
go test ./...
|
go test ./...
|
||||||
@ -21,4 +24,4 @@ watch:
|
|||||||
modd
|
modd
|
||||||
|
|
||||||
clean:
|
clean:
|
||||||
rm -f ${BIN_NAME}*
|
rm -f ${BIN_NAME}* dist/${BIN_NAME}*
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user